Programs Offered

Learn Automation Testing to streamline software quality assurance using tools like Selenium, JUnit, and TestNG. This course covers writing test scripts, frameworks, and continuous testing integration.

img

Designed to equip you with hands-on skills to build, execute, and maintain automated test scripts

img
Manual Testing Foundations
img
Programming for Test Automation
img
Automation Tools
img
Test Framework Development

Automation Testing Course Intro

Automation testing has become an essential skill in the software development lifecycle, streamlining testing processes, improving accuracy, and reducing manual effort.

  • In-Depth Tool Training
  • Hands-On Projects
  • Framework Development
  • Continuous Integration (CI) Integration
  • Debugging and Maintenance Skills
  • Expert Guidance and Community Support

Learning Path

  • Course 1Master the Basics of Manual Testing
  • Course 2Learn Programming Fundamentals
  • Course 3Familiarize Yourself with Automation Tools
  • Course 4Dive into Test Frameworks
  • Course 5Explore API Testing Automation
  • Masters Certificate+ Individual certification for each courses*

Technologies and Tools Covered

 
img
img
img
img
img
 

Complementary Module

img

Project Management Module

This project management module equips you with the foundational skills to plan, track, and manage projects successfully.

img

GIT Training Module

Gain essential skills in version control with this Git training module. Ideal for both beginners and seasoned developers.

img

Technical Documentation

This course dives into the essentials of technical documentation, teaching you how to create clear, structured.

img

Technical Documentation

This module covers the core principles and tools needed to create, maintain, and enhance technical documentation.

"The only constant in the technology industry is change." – Marc Benioff

Key Takeaways from Testing Course

 

In-Demand Skillset

Gain expertise in automation testing, a highly sought-after skill in today’s tech industry, opening doors to various job roles.

Hands-On Experience

Work on real-world projects that provide practical, applicable skills in automating web, mobile, and API testing processes.

Comprehensive Tool Proficiency

Master essential automation tools like Selenium, Appium, and JUnit, enabling you to test across different platforms and technologies.

img

Beginner to Intermediate

Skill Level

img

160+ Hours

Course Duration

img

24-40+ Hours

Interactive Sessions with Experts

img

25+ Hours

Projects & Quizzes

Our Automation Testing Course equips you with the skills to create, execute, and maintain automated tests for web, mobile, and API applications. Dive into popular tools like Selenium, Appium, and JUnit, and gain hands-on experience in building robust test frameworks and integrating testing into CI/CD pipelines.

Key Modules of Automation Testing

The Automation Testing Course offers a comprehensive curriculum designed to equip learners with the essential skills and knowledge needed to excel in the field of software testing. Beginning with an introduction to software testing fundamentals, students will gain a solid foundation in testing methodologies and principles.

img

Introduction to Software Testing

• Overview of software testing and its importance   
• Types of testing (manual vs. automated)   
• Key testing principles and methodologies   
• Understanding the software development lifecycle (SDLC)   
• Introduction to test planning and management

Programming Fundamentals for Test Automation

• Basics of programming with Java/Python/JavaScript   
• Variables, data types, and control structures   
• Functions, loops, and error handling   
• Object-oriented programming principles   
• Writing reusable code for test automation

Automation Tools: Selenium & Appium

• Setting up Selenium WebDriver and IDE   
• Writing automated scripts for web applications   
• Introduction to Appium for mobile testing   
• Element locators and selectors   
• Handling browser actions, pop-ups, and alerts

Test Framework Development

• Introduction to test frameworks (JUnit, TestNG)   
• Building reusable and scalable test structures   
• Data-driven and keyword-driven frameworks   
• Organizing test cases and test suites   
• Best practices for framework maintenance

API Testing Automation

• Introduction to API testing and REST APIs   
• Using Postman for manual API testing   
• Automating API tests with RestAssured   
• Validating responses, headers, and error codes   
• Integrating API tests into automation frameworks

Continuous Integration & CI/CD Pipeline Integration

• Basics of Continuous Integration (CI) and Continuous Deployment (CD)   
• Configuring Jenkins for automated test execution   
• Integrating Git for version control   
• Running automated tests in CI/CD pipelines   
• Monitoring and reporting test results

most asked questions

Find answers here

Want to excel in software testing with in-demand automation skills?

Techdemy’s Automation Testing course offers flexible online and in-person training to fit your schedule. Our hands-on syllabus focuses on real-world projects to help you become proficient in testing automation tools and frameworks.

Techdemy's Automation Testing Program Highlights

We provide flexible and 24/7 online learning that fits around You. Become an industry leader with accredited undergraduate and postgraduate courses online. Fully Online.

Comprehensive Tool Training

Master industry-leading automation tools like Selenium, Appium, JUnit, TestNG, and Postman, covering all major testing environments.

Hands-On Projects

Work on real-world projects that simulate industry scenarios, allowing you to practice and apply your skills in web, mobile, and API testing.

Framework Development

Learn how to create scalable, reusable automation frameworks, equipping you with best practices for designing structured and efficient test systems.

Become a Part of Our Community!

Have questions about our courses or need personalized guidance?

Reach out to us today, and our team will assist you in finding the perfect training program to boost your skills and career!

 

Get in Touch with Techdemy

Choose Course